Understanding and Managing Feline Upper Respiratory Infections

Cats can experience upper respiratory infections, often referred to as 'cat colds,' which, while distinct from human colds, manifest with comparable symptoms such as sneezing, coughing, and ocular/nasal discharge. These conditions are predominantly virally induced, with most mild cases resolving spontaneously within a week to ten days. However, certain situations may necessitate veterinary intervention due to complications.

Feline upper respiratory infections are a common ailment, primarily caused by highly contagious viruses like feline herpesvirus and feline calicivirus, which account for approximately 90% of cases. Feline herpesvirus, also known as feline rhinotracheitis virus, is especially prevalent in multi-cat environments, including shelters and breeding facilities. Once a cat contracts this virus, it becomes a lifelong carrier, with the virus potentially reactivating during periods of stress, leading to temporary symptoms. Feline calicivirus similarly causes respiratory issues and is noted for often inducing painful oral ulcers. Fortunately, these viruses are species-specific and do not pose a risk of transmission to humans. Vaccinations are crucial in reducing the severity of these infections and offering protection against serious illness.

Diagnosing these conditions typically involves a comprehensive veterinary examination, where the owner's detailed account of the cat's symptoms and medical history is invaluable. For mild cases, extensive diagnostic tests are rarely necessary. However, if complications such as pneumonia or secondary bacterial infections are suspected, veterinarians might recommend blood tests or chest X-rays. In instances of recurrent or severe respiratory signs, a PCR panel may be utilized to identify the specific pathogens involved.

Treatment strategies vary based on the severity of the infection. Mild cases often respond well to supportive home care, which can include placing the cat in a steamy bathroom to alleviate congestion, using humidifiers, and ensuring a calm, stress-free environment. Pheromone products can also aid in reducing stress. More severe infections, or those complicated by secondary bacterial infections, may require antibiotics. Antiviral medications may be prescribed for severe feline herpesvirus infections, particularly in immunocompromised cats. In critical situations, hospitalization for supportive care may be required until the cat stabilizes.

Recovery from a mild feline cold typically occurs within 7 to 10 days with appropriate supportive care. During this period, it's essential for pet owners to closely monitor their cat's appetite, energy levels, breathing patterns, and any eye or nasal discharge. While most viral infections resolve without extensive medical treatment, complications like bacterial infections or pneumonia can prolong recovery and necessitate further veterinary attention. Adhering to the veterinarian's treatment recommendations and minimizing stress are key factors in promoting healing and preventing additional health issues.

The Evolution and Current Landscape of Veterinary Management Systems

The veterinary industry has witnessed a significant transformation in practice management, transitioning from manual, paper-based systems to integrated digital platforms. Initially, veterinary practices relied heavily on handwritten records, often leading to incomplete documentation and communication challenges. The advent of practice information management systems (PIMS) marked a pivotal shift, consolidating various operational aspects such as billing, client communication, electronic medical records (EMR), and inventory management into unified software solutions. Early PIMS were typically server-based, limiting accessibility, but the industry is now overwhelmingly moving towards cloud-based models. This transition allows for remote access, greater flexibility, and enhanced collaboration among veterinary teams, fundamentally altering day-to-day clinic functions and improving overall efficiency.

Today's PIMS offerings are diverse, ranging from well-established industry leaders to innovative newcomers, each providing unique features tailored to different practice needs. Platforms like Covetrus Pulse and ezyVet offer extensive integrations with supply chains, pharmacies, and even incorporate artificial intelligence for advanced functionalities. Other systems, such as DaySmart Vet and IDEXX Neo, prioritize ease of use, making them ideal for smaller or mobile practices. IDEXX Cornerstone, while server-based, caters to larger clinics with complex demands. Newer entrants like NectarVet, Provet, Digitail, and Shepherd Veterinary Software are pushing boundaries with features like AI Scribes, integrated telehealth options, and comprehensive analytical tools, signaling a continuous evolution in enhancing veterinary practice capabilities and client engagement.

Transforming Veterinary Practice with Integrated Solutions and AI

The widespread adoption of integrated practice information management systems (PIMS) is fundamentally reshaping the operational landscape of veterinary clinics. These comprehensive solutions offer a multitude of benefits, centralizing diverse functions such as patient scheduling, billing, and electronic medical records into a single, cohesive platform. Beyond these core capabilities, modern PIMS often include integrated inventory management, automated client communication tools, and even interactive whiteboards for patient care coordination. The incorporation of artificial intelligence (AI), particularly in the form of AI scribes, represents a significant advancement. These tools automate documentation, reducing the clerical burden on veterinarians and allowing them to focus more intently on diagnosis and treatment. This shift not only enhances operational efficiency but also plays a crucial role in minimizing missed charges and improving the accuracy and accessibility of patient data, ultimately elevating the standard of care.

Despite the clear advantages, implementing and optimizing a PIMS requires navigating certain challenges, including a learning curve for staff and the need to choose a system that aligns with a practice's specific requirements. However, the benefits of embracing these technologies far outweigh the initial hurdles. AI scribes, whether integrated or standalone, are proving to be invaluable time-savers, mitigating professional burnout and improving the quality of clinical notes. Additionally, advanced communication platforms, often integrated with PIMS, facilitate seamless interactions with clients through two-way texting, online booking, and digital forms, fostering stronger client relationships. As the veterinary software market continues to grow and innovate, clinics must stay informed about emerging trends, including cybersecurity best practices and the importance of backup power solutions for cloud-based systems, to fully leverage these powerful tools for improved practice management and superior patient outcomes.

Selecting the Right Flea and Tick Pill for Your Dog

Choosing the ideal oral medication for flea and tick control for your dog involves a personalized approach, taking into account several key elements. Primarily, your dog's overall health condition is paramount; certain pre-existing ailments might contraindicate specific active ingredients. The dog's size and age are also critical determinants, as dosages and product formulations are often tailored to these characteristics. Furthermore, your geographic location plays a significant role, influencing the prevalence of different parasite species and their resistance patterns, thereby guiding the selection of the most potent treatment. Consulting with a veterinarian to assess these factors and recommend a product that aligns with your dog's specific needs and local parasite threats is highly advisable. This strategic selection helps in providing effective relief from current infestations and acts as a preventative measure against future parasitic challenges, ensuring your dog's comfort and health.
